Disqualification is another method of determining bidder "responsibility" (see 4.1). Disqualification may prohibit a contractor from bidding on University projects for a set period of time, whereas prequalification (see 4.3) and qualification (see 4.4) evaluate contractors for bidding on a specific project or on a … See more The application of standard, predetermined responsibility requirements in the bidding documents is the most frequently used method of determining bidder "responsibility."
